Output 5095d7068a239435b72c007796018b14873b966b1529d4c2e1f235a0e9b393b6:9

value
184916
script pubkey
OP_0 OP_PUSHBYTES_20 5ebc290fbf7a807ede49490c3edd2710d606341e
address
bc1qt67zjral02q8ahjffyxrahf8zrtqvdq7w3tath
transaction
5095d7068a239435b72c007796018b14873b966b1529d4c2e1f235a0e9b393b6